To convert a percentage to a decimal, you need to divide the percentage by 100 To convert 85 percent to a decimal, you simply divide the percentage figure by 100 This is because percent means per hundred, so 85% is the same as 85 per 100
When you divide 85 by 100, you get 0.85
Another way to think about it is to move the decimal point two places to the left. What is 85% in decimal form 85% as a decimal is 0.85 So, 85% means 85 per 100 or simply 85/100
